Pros

The job is very flexible. As a business student, I was able to gain experience while continuing my education. For the most part, you create your own schedule according to the project you are on and time you may need off for personal/school reasons.

Cons

CMU-RC is a not-for-profit organization so the compensation is very low compared to similar positions at other consulting firms. When a dedicated co-worker asked for a raise for doing tasks that were outside of his job description and should have been performed by his supervisor, management denied him. Their excuse: "we are paying you in experience". Employee moral and satisfaction is not a priority, especially for intern positions. Unfortunately, CMU-RC tries to provide the services of a consulting/ market research firm, but they lack the resources for their employees to provide these services.
